Your role in the Team's Success: The Head of Compliance for IG's institutional business is responsible for designing, implementing, and overseeing the comprehensive compliance program across all institutional client segments. This senior leadership role will ensure regulatory compliance while supporting business objectives, managing regulatory relationships, and fostering a culture of compliance throughout the institutional business division.

What you'll do:

  • Working with cross-functional teams to develop and implement policies, procedures and controls to ensure regulatory compliance across multiple jurisdictions and financial products, including physical and synthetic prime brokerage as well as digital assets.
  • Monitor changes in regulations and assess the impact on institutional business operations.
  • Conduct compliance risk assessments and design mitigation strategies specific to our institutional business.
  • Build and maintain regulatory relationships and lead regulatory examinations, audits and investigations within the institutional business.
  • Report compliance matters to senior management, board committees, and regulators as required.
  • Lead and develop a team of compliance professionals and deliver compliance training programs for institutional business staff.

What you'll need for this role:

  • 10+ years of experience in compliance, with at least 5 years focused on institutional business and/or corporate banking.
  • Strong understanding of IG's product offering; experience with a range of financial products, including physical and synthetic prime brokerage, as well as digital assets.
  • Advanced degree in Law, Business, Finance, or related field.
  • Professional compliance certification preferred (CAMS, CCEP, or equivalent).
  • Thorough knowledge of regulations affecting institutional clients (BSA/AML, OFAC, MiFID II, etc.).
  • Experience developing compliance programs for complex institutional products and services and interfacing with regulators.
  • Proven leadership skills and ability to influence across organisational boundaries.
